Abstract: Precise individualized procedures and nutritional interventions may be determined for patients with musculoskeletal pain by using Indicator Testing.
Indicator testing for nutritional supplements measures pain and/or range of motion before and after the patient tastes a supplement.
The most important nutritional supplements to be measured by Indictor Testing in patients with musculoskeletal pain are essential fatty acids, manganese, and cartilage producing substances including chondroitin sulfate and/or glucosamine sulfate, methylsulfonylmethane (MSM), and the amino acid L-cysteine.
